Apple Pecan Streusel Cake
Ingredients:
1 (18.25-ounce) package white cake mix
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
1 1/4 cups water
1/3 cup vegetable oil
3 large eggs
1/2 teaspoon almond extract
1/4 cup firmly packed brown sugar
1/4 cup chopped pecans
2 apples, peeled, cored and chopped
1/2 cup powdered sugar
2 teaspoons lemon juice
1. Preheat oven to 350*F.
2. In a large bowl, combine white cake mix, 1 tablespoon
cinnamon, water, oil, eggs, and almond extract. Beat at low
speed with an electric mixer until moistened. Beat for 2 minutes
at medium speed. Pour two-thirds of the batter into greased and
floured tube pan.
3. In a small bowl, mix 1 teaspoon cinnamon, brown sugar, and
chopped pecans. Spread half of the cinnamon mixture and 2
chopped apples over the batter, then spoon the remaining batter
on top. Sprinkle the remaining pecan mixture on top.
4. Bake for 35 to 40 minutes, or until the center is set. Cool.
Drizzle with a glaze of powdered sugar and lemon juice.
Makes 12 servings.
